Before your appointment make sure your skin is completely bare and makeup-free. Arrive with a bare face so your esthetician can conduct a thorough skin analysis. If you apply retinoids, acids, or other active topicals be sure to inform your provider in advance, as these can significantly alter your skin’s reactivity.
Moisture is non-negotiable both during and after your facial. Within 30 minutes of treatment apply a gentle hydrating serum followed by a rich, non-comedogenic moisturizer. Refrain from abrasive treatments for the next two days, as your skin is post-treatment reactive. Consume plenty of fluids throughout the day to support skin health from within.
Sun protection is absolutely essential—no matter how superficial the peel your skin becomes highly vulnerable to sun exposure. Never skip a broad-spectrum sunscreen with a minimum of 30 SPF, and reapply every two hours if you’re spending time in direct sunlight.
Pair professional treatments with a simple but effective at-home routine. Use a gentle cleanser in the morning and evening, layer a brightening ascorbic acid product during the day, and use a nightly retinoid before bed. These steps will amplify the effects of your professional facials and preserve your radiance.
Steer clear of cigarettes and reduce your intake of spirits, as both habits accelerate skin aging. Get 7–9 hours nightly and reduce daily tension, because your skin reflects your inner health. Emotional balance and consistent rest are key drivers of a ageless, glowing complexion.
Finally, be open and honest with your esthetician—tell them what changes you’ve noticed and your desired outcomes. This allows for dynamic adjustments and maximizes the effectiveness of every visit.
